From 02202fb7800ac6e145ee6cc6ef38b95e7d105a58 Mon Sep 17 00:00:00 2001 From: Bryan Naegele Date: Sat, 16 Sep 2023 09:17:35 -0600 Subject: [PATCH] Add strict version type for setup-beam (#206) --- .github/workflows/elixir.yml | 12 ++++++++++++ .github/workflows/erlang.yml | 6 ++++++ 2 files changed, 18 insertions(+) diff --git a/.github/workflows/elixir.yml b/.github/workflows/elixir.yml index e9c3c40a..35932d3e 100644 --- a/.github/workflows/elixir.yml +++ b/.github/workflows/elixir.yml @@ -54,6 +54,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-101,6 +102,7 @@ jobs: - uses: actions/checkout@v2 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-139,6 +141,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-177,6 +180,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-215,6 +219,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-262,6 +267,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-300,6 +306,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-342,6 +349,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-380,6 +388,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-418,6 +427,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-456,6 +466,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} @@ -494,6 +505,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} elixir-version: ${{ matrix.elixir_version }} rebar3-version: ${{ matrix.rebar3_version }} diff --git a/.github/workflows/erlang.yml b/.github/workflows/erlang.yml index a38757a9..46fcf90a 100644 --- a/.github/workflows/erlang.yml +++ b/.github/workflows/erlang.yml @@ -44,6 +44,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} rebar3-version: ${{ matrix.rebar3_version }} - name: Cache @@ -75,6 +76,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} rebar3-version: ${{ matrix.rebar3_version }} - name: Cache @@ -106,6 +108,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} rebar3-version: ${{ matrix.rebar3_version }} - name: Cache @@ -137,6 +140,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} rebar3-version: ${{ matrix.rebar3_version }} - name: Cache @@ -168,6 +172,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} rebar3-version: ${{ matrix.rebar3_version }} - name: Cache @@ -199,6 +204,7 @@ jobs: - uses: actions/checkout@v3 - uses: erlef/setup-beam@v1 with: + version-type: strict otp-version: ${{ matrix.otp_version }} rebar3-version: ${{ matrix.rebar3_version }} - name: Cache